ST. LOUIS, MO (KTVI) – A long winter and repeated cool spells have really put a damper on the aquatic recreation this year. But, it cannot last forever. Before long the lazy, hazy, days of summer will be here which means the boats , jet skis and water skis will soon be out in force.
The latest statistics from the US Coast Guard show that when it comes to boating mishaps Missouri is the 8th most accident prone state in the country, Illinois is 23rd. The overwhelming majority of fatalities nationwide in those accidents, a startling 84%, are people who drown while not wearing a life jacket.
The Missouri Highway Patrol suggests that everyone take a safe boating course before hitting the water.
